WHAT IT'S ABOUT
Most founders pour themselves into the product. But a business is far more than its product. It is who you serve, what you actually do for them, how you reach them, how the money moves, how the pieces fit. That is your business model, and it is easy to forget it even exists when the product is eating all your attention.
The moment you see the business as the whole model, not just the thing you build, you hit a wall: it cannot live only in your head. It has to be written down. And not written once. Kept current as you learn, which is the hard part almost nobody does.
This is an old problem with a short history. For years the answer was the business plan, twenty pages, written once, read by no one, stale the day it was printed. Then came the lean canvas: the whole model on a single page, essentials only. The breakthrough was not brevity. It was that a one-pager is something you can point at, react to, and revise together. That is what lets you iterate fast and stay coordinated with partners, clients, and advisors, working from one shared reference instead of long stories that drift.
Now AI raises the stakes again. AI can act as your strategist and your operator, but only if it has that same one page. Without it, it guesses, every time, no matter how good the model. With it, it compounds.
And then the deeper layer, the one nobody checks. Even when it is written, even with AI in the loop, does everyone actually understand it the same way? Your partners? Your clients? Your AI? Do you? Here is the strange part: most of us quietly feel a little unseen, sure nobody fully gets us, while we are just as quietly certain that we understand everyone else fine. Both can't be true. The gap is almost always in the direction we never check, and it is a quiet reason partnerships break, projects stall, and AI keeps disappointing you.
